The Benefits of Semiconductor Manufacturing in Low Earth Orbit (LEO) for Terrestrial Use
NASA astronaut and Expedition 65 Flight Engineer Megan McArthur works in the Microgravity Science Glovebox swapping samples for an experiment called Solidification Using a Baffle in Sealed Ampoules, or SUBSA.
